Angela

On June, 19, 2018 Angela lost her home. She was in the final stages of a divorce and her 12- year old daughter went to spend the summer with her father. Angela and her two youngest children moved in with an out of state family member until she could find a job and get back on her feet. After 9 days, it was clear to her that this arrangement was not going to work out. Emotional, with nowhere to go and no one else to turn to she returned to Atlanta.

We were back to the drawing board and living in our car again. Every assistance program I called was not able to help me or I was put on a waiting list. Through the grace of God, I found SVdP,” she said. “My children and I were able to have two weeks at an extended stay hotel. I was also given gas money, sources for further assistance, and interview clothes because I was still trying to find a job. I got the job and one of the agencies they sent me to helped me find an apartment and helped with two months rent until I got my first two paychecks. It’s hard being a single mother and starting all over again. I am grateful and thankful that I have my three children together and we have a roof over our heads. I am so thankful for all those that God put in my path to help me.
